> As it came out, as usual, I unpacked the new revision of the debian linux
> kernel sources, copied over the .config file from the previous one, made a
> make oldconfig and built a kernel image using make-kpkg.  Everything went
> smoothly, as far as I can tell.  I then installed the new image it on my
> laptop, and rebooted into it, to find out that _any_ 32 bit executable would
> segfault! Even the ld-linux linker itself!
>
> I reinstalled the old package, rebooted, and I had 32 bit compatibility
> back.
>
> Does anybody know what the heck I did wrong? Or what changed between the -6
> and the -7 version of linux-source-2.6.32 that might have caused this?
